Latest Patents
One of Vallance's latest patents is titled "Split via surface mount connector and related techniques." This invention involves an interconnection circuit that features a plated through hole with multiple electrically isolated segments. These segments are designed to couple to a signal path and ground, allowing for effective impedance matching in multilayer circuit boards. This innovation ensures the integrity of high-frequency signals as they propagate between different layers. Another significant patent is the "Manipulator for automatic test equipment test head." This device addresses the challenges posed by heavy, inflexible cables connected to test heads. It includes a telescoping column assembly and a cradle that allows for fine positioning of the test head while minimizing the impact of cable force.
